The women’s prison deprived of drinking water and showers by a bacterium

The first alert fell a fortnight ago. Since that date, the 200 inmates of the women’s prison in Rennes no longer have the right to drink drinking water. They are not the only ones concerned. The semi-freedom district where men are detained is also concerned, as are the radicalization management district and the offices of the interregional management of the prison administration. In total, 500 to 600 people were deprived of water at the height of the alert. The reason ? The water has become undrinkable due to the presence of a bacterium, has learned 20 minutesconfirming information from West France.

According to the management, the alert would have been given after exceeding the potability thresholds recorded during tests which are regularly carried out. “There was a little concern. As a precaution, we preferred to prohibit access to drinking water everywhere. Since then, we have been progressing step by step to identify the exact problem, ”explains the management of the penitentiary establishment, which distributed bottles and made water fountains available.

Officials of the almost 150-year-old prison are not worried more than that, aware that the dilapidated pipes are probably the source of this bacterium. To eradicate it, chemical treatments were carried out in the pipes. During this period, showers were also impossible for inmates. The management has not noted any cases of illnesses linked to this bacterium. The water is still not drinkable and it will take several more weeks for the establishment to return to normal operation.
